About

Jatin Narula is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Genetics and Ecology. According to data from OpenAlex, Jatin Narula has authored 20 papers receiving a total of 447 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in Molecular Biology, 6 papers in Genetics and 3 papers in Ecology. Recurrent topics in Jatin Narula's work include Gene Regulatory Network Analysis (8 papers), Bacterial Genetics and Biotechnology (6 papers) and Bacteriophages and microbial interactions (3 papers). Jatin Narula is often cited by papers focused on Gene Regulatory Network Analysis (8 papers), Bacterial Genetics and Biotechnology (6 papers) and Bacteriophages and microbial interactions (3 papers). Jatin Narula collaborates with scholars based in United States, Australia and India. Jatin Narula's co-authors include Oleg A. Igoshin, Masaya Fujita, Abhinav Tiwari, Anna Kuchina, Gürol M. Süel, J. Christian J. Ray, Berthold Göttgens, Aileen M. Smith, Stanislaus J. Schymanski and Axel Kleidon and has published in prestigious journals such as Cell,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ences and S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ología.
